日期:2014-05-17  浏览次数:20657 次

新手的困惑
我原来是学习MSSQL SERVER 的,在2000里可以使用T-SQL创建用户及为用户分配权限和密码,而且是用的函数分配权限的。现在刚接触ORACLE ,想知道有没有想T-SQL一样的为创建和分配权限的函数,以及如何使用!能实现网络登录及各自使用自己创建的表空间的 功能!

------解决方案--------------------
oracle的权限是通过命令来授权的,如:

1、创建用户
sql>create user test identified by test default tablespace users;

2、授权
sql>grant connect,resource,unlimited tablespace to test;

connect:连接角色,最基本的;
resource:能创建基本对象的角色;
unlimited tablespace:无表空间大小限制。
------解决方案--------------------
只有"GRANT 权限 ON TABLE TO USER "授权语句的使用
详细可以GOOGLE
------解决方案--------------------
当然有了 Oracle时功能相当强大的数据块系统 。 详细的查看Oracle 官方文档 。